    I took my Day One Xbox One apart yesterday to clean 4 years worth of dust and cat hair out of it since it has started to run a little louder and "hotter" than normal. After putting it back together I did a network test and it says there is a problem with
    with the wireless hardware and needs to be repaired also my wireless controllers will not sync. I did some research and the wireless card apparently handles Bluetooth as well as Wifi. I never use wifi so Im ok with that not working however I would like the
    Bluetooth functionality. I've seen replacement wireless cards online, is that something that can be swaped out by Plug-n-Play or would it need to be reformatted or something before it would work? Repairing it myself would be better for me since it's out of
    warranty and I don't want to be without my X1 for an unknown length of time but I don't want to spend the money on a replacement wireless card if just doing a straight swap will not work. PLEASE HELP.

    Xbox one wireless hardware

    It works using the ethernet cable. But i want to connect wireless. I don’t want my ethernet cable all around the house
    If it works with ethernet but not wireless then your gateway/router is not broadcasting it's SSID or the console is in a position with signal interference.

    Do other devices detect the WiFi signal?
